Abstract

The invention provides a rapid die release mechanism of a vertical pipe expansion machine, which comprises a die release base, lower screws and nuts and is characterized in that lower screws are vertically arranged at two sides of the die release base, the upper nuts are arranged at the upper ends of the lower screws, die release cylinders are arranged on two side surfaces of the die release base, and piston rods of the die release cylinders are connected with the nuts. The die release base can be quickly moved through the arrangement of the die release cylinders on a die release plate, and the work efficiency is improved. Due to arrangement of a climb, the rapid die release mechanism is convenient for operation and maintenance on one side, and the anti-bending capability of the rapid die release mechanism can be enhanced on the other side.

Background technology
Electric tube expander is to be used for making it to combine closely with fin with placing the numerous heat exchanger pipe fitting diameters in the fin to swell, and avoids producing and becomes flexible, and increases the heat conductivility of heat exchanger, in addition pipe fitting end is carried out enlarging and flange, is beneficial to carry out next procedure.
Existing vertical pipe expander comprises base, is installed in frame, power seat, the enlarging seat on the base and moves back die holder; Expander roll is installed on the power seat, and expander roll passes a plurality of gripper shoes and by the gripper shoe fixed support, moves back die holder and generally driven by the screw body that is installed on the support; The nut of screw body directly is fixed on and moves back on the die holder; Therefore move back moving of die holder and rely on screw body fully, translational speed is slower, and operating efficiency is lower.
